Start your honeymoon journey in the charming hill station of Shimla. In the morning, take a leisurely walk on the bustling Mall Road, lined with shops and cafes. Enjoy the panoramic views from the Ridge, a popular viewpoint. In the afternoon, visit the Viceregal Lodge, a magnificent colonial-era building. As the evening sets in, take a romantic horse ride to Jakhoo Hill and visit the Jakhoo Temple.
Embark on a scenic drive from Shimla to Manali, a picturesque hill station. In the morning, explore the famous Hadimba Devi Temple, set amidst deodar forests. Enjoy an adventurous paragliding experience in Solang Valley in the afternoon. As the evening sets in, take a romantic stroll along the Mall Road and indulge in shopping for local handicrafts.
Embark on a thrilling excursion to Rohtang Pass, a high mountain pass. In the morning, enjoy the panoramic views of snow-capped peaks and visit the picturesque Rahala Falls. Take part in fun snow activities such as skiing and snowboarding in the afternoon. As the evening sets in, return to Manali and relax in the hot sulfur springs of Vashisht.
Travel to the peaceful town of Dharamshala, known for its Tibetan culture and stunning landscapes. In the morning, visit the spiritual abode of the Dalai Lama, the Tsuglagkhang Complex. Explore the scenic Bhagsu Waterfall and Bhagsunath Temple in the afternoon. As the evening sets in, take a soothing walk in the serene Dal Lake.
Head to the picturesque town of Dalhousie, known for its colonial charm and breathtaking vistas. In the morning, visit the St. John's Church and soak in the peaceful atmosphere. Explore the Kalatop Wildlife Sanctuary and enjoy a picnic amidst nature. As the evening sets in, take a romantic walk along the scenic Chamera Lake.
End your honeymoon trip with a visit to the serene town of Chail. In the morning, visit the Chail Palace, a former summer retreat of the Maharaja of Patiala. Enjoy a thrilling zipline adventure amidst the beautiful pine forests in the afternoon. As the evening sets in, take a leisurely walk around the Chail Cricket Ground, the highest cricket ground in the world.
For a romantic and off-the-beaten-path experience, consider visiting the picturesque village of Tirthan Valley. It offers scenic landscapes, pristine rivers, and opportunities for trout fishing. Another hidden gem is the serene village of Kasol, known for its hippie culture, beautiful Parvati River, and scenic hikes. These destinations offer a tranquil escape for honeymooners looking to connect with nature and each other.
